Who We Are

The Office of Institutional Effectiveness and Evaluation is committed to fostering assessment practices university-wide by supporting the collection, analysis, management, and use of data. We facilitate efforts of continuous improvement to enhance student learning and strengthen the university’s programs, services, operations, and processes. Institutional Effectiveness – or “IE” – refers to the process of assessing the quality of student learning, educational programs, academic and student support services, and the administrative units across the university. OIEE staff support the institution in evaluating the extent to which established goals are met and help to facilitate the use of results from these evaluations to inform decision-making and improvements.
